Queensland Catholic School Data Collections

There are a number of data collections that occur each year, some of them are government collections while others are to fulfil requirements that meet funding accountabilities or to provide statistical data for annual reporting on Catholic schools.

The State Census is the most significant data collection that occurs in the first quarter of the year. Due to the delayed start of 2022, the Non-State Schools Accreditation Board (NSSAB)  has made some changes regarding the attendance requirement for including students. Full details have been provided to all Catholic School Authorities (CSAs), however in summary, all full-time students will need to attend for at least six days between 7 February 2022 and 25 February 2022 to be eligible for inclusion in the Census, unless the absence is beyond the control of the parent, guardian or student (if living independently).

More detailed information regarding completion of the Census was provided to CSAs and school Principals in the 2022 Census letter and Instructions issued by the NSSAB on 1 February.
